can be able to 的区别

我可以这么说吗?can表示客观的通过各种学习而获得的能力,而be able to不仅仅强调能力,还强调在某种特定情况下没有完成的动作。
例如说:你能再说一遍吗?我刚才没能跟上你。
这个时候用can不行,因为说话者本身就具有能跟上的能力。
而可以用be able to 说明我刚才只是没能跟上你。

我说的对吗???

嗯,楼主说的没有错,can仅限表现能力,而be able to可能会指一些客观原因导致无法完成的结果。另一方面,can所能表达的含义更多一些,如允许。但be able to 所能表达的时态比can广泛很多。can只能用于一般现在时或一般过去时(could),不能说will can.而相比之下,be able to 可以变形为was able to/is able to/will be able to,能够用的地方更多。
我们老师是这样说的,希望可以帮到你!
温馨提示:内容为网友见解,仅供参考
第1个回答  2009-10-02
说的对,具体区别如下
1)can could 表示能力;可能 (过去时用could),
只用于现在式和过去式(could)。be able to可以用于各种时态。
They will be able to tell you the news soon. 他很快就能告诉你消息了。

2)只用be able to
a. 位于助动词后。
b. 情态动词后。
c. 表示过去某时刻动作时。
d. 用于句首表示条件。
e. 表示成功地做了某事时,只能用was/were able to, 不能用could。
He was able to flee Europe before the war broke out.
= He managed to flee Europe before the war broke out.

注意:could不表示时态

1)提出委婉的请求,(注意在回答中不可用could)。
--- Could I have the television on?
--- Yes, you can. / No, you can't.

2)在否定,疑问句中表示推测或怀疑。
He couldn't be a bad man.
他不大可能是坏人。

can用于表示“能力”时是指现在的能力,过去或将来的能力通常用was/were able to或will/shall be able to表示。

eg. She was able to go to school yesterday.
Soon she will be able to swim a quarter of a mile.

Can的过去式形式could也可用于表示泛指过去的能力。如:

I could read when I was four.

但不能用于表示特定的某一过去能力,如不能说:
*He could swim halfway before he got tired.
He was able to swim halfway before he got tired.

上述这种用法的区别不存在于否定句中。在否定句中,couldn’t与was/were not able to 可以互换使用。

eg. I couldn’t see him again before he left.
I wasn’t able to see him again before he left.

另外,要说一个阶段延续至今的能力,可用have/has been able to表示。

eg. John has been able to swim for many years.

注意的一点是:can也可以用于表示“许可”。它可以表示现在许可或将来许可,过去许可用could表示,此时一律不能用be able to的某种形式替换。

另外,can可以表示与生俱来的能力, be able to 有时指后天习得的能力,本质上有区别,但是口语当中可以互相转换

be able to与can的区别
“be able to”与“can”在英语中均表示“能做”的意思,但它们在表述、重点与强度方面存在差异。使用与侧重:“be able to”适用于需要努力才能达成的事情,接动词原形,强调能力。例:经过数月的训练,他能跳过墙壁。"can"则侧重于能力、可能性或允许做某事,接动词原形或完成式,表示“可以”。例...

can和beableto有什么区别?
Can和be able to都表示能力,但在用法和语境上存在一些差异。二、详细解释 1.基本含义 Can:表示一种普遍或固有的能力。它强调某人有做某事的基本能力或天赋技能。Be able to:表示一种可能或潜在的能力。它强调的是在特定情况下,某人能否成功完成某项任务或动作。2.用法差异 Can多用于疑问句和否定...

can和beableto的区别是什么?
总结来说,Can更多地强调主体的内在能力或潜力,而be able to则侧重于在特定情境或条件下的实际能力。两者在时态、语态和用法上也有所不同。理解这两者的差异有助于我们更准确地使用这两个表达。

can和be able to的区别
can和be able to的区别:侧重点不同、时态不同、用法不同、含义不同。1、侧重点不同 be able to强调通过努力而获得的能力,而can则强调自身已具有的能力。be able to 强调一种结果,而can只强调一种可能。2、时态不同 从时态形式来看,can 只有现在式和过去式(could),而 be able to 则可根据...

can和be able to用法上的区别
区别一:强调重点不同 1、be able to 强调通过努力而获得的能力。2、can则强调自身已具有的能力。如:She can sing the song in English。她能用英语唱这首歌。区别二:强调内容不同 1、be able to强调一种结果,Luckily,he was able to escape from the big fire in the end。幸运的是,他...

can 和be able to的区别
Ⅱ. be able to 的过去时还可表一种“经过努力做到了”的意思。而can的过去时则没有这种意义。如:He started late, but he was able to catch the eight o’clock train. 他出发晚了,但他还是赶上了八点钟的火车。Ⅲ.can 通常只用于上述两种时态,而be able to 则可用于各种时态。如:He...

be able to和can的区别
be able to和can的区别具体如下:1、be able to英 [bi: ˈeibl tu:] 美 [bi ˈebəl tu]v.能够;能,会;克;be able to是半助动词,可以用于各种时态。例句:They have not been able to go to school for two weeks.他们已有两周没能去上学了。2、can英 [kæ...

can与be able to的区别是什么?
be able to 和can的区别:1、当它们表示能力的时候,是一样的。2、 can只有两种时态,即can 和could, 而be able to 有多种时态,如was\/were able to, will\/shall be able to, have\/has been able to等。3、表示过去通过努力终于做成了某事要用be able to,而不能用can。4、can能表猜测...

can与beableto的区别
Can与Be able to的区别 一、基本区别 Can:是情态动词,用来表达能力或可能性,侧重于客观存在的能力或条件。Be able to:是表示能力的常用表达,强调通过努力或某种条件能够完成某事,侧重于主观能力。二、详细解释 1. 用法差异 Can:用于表达天赋或自然能力,也可用于表达可能性或推测。例如:“...

can和beableto的区别
can和be able to的区别 一、答案 can和be able to都可以表达能力或可能性,但两者在使用和语义上存在一些差异。二、详细解释 1.基本含义 - can:是一个情态动词,用来表达能力或可能性,还可以表示许可、请求等。- be able to:表示“有能力做某事”,强调通过努力或某种条件能够完成某事...

相似回答